This volume, in the Osprey Military Fighting Elite series, contains detailed information on the uniforms and insignia of one of the world's most famous military forces. While the U.S. Marine Corps was one of the smallest of American armed services in World War II, its contribution to the final victory cannot be overstated, and the Marines suffered 10% of the nation's combat casualties. By the end of the war, 98% of the Marine Corps' officers and 89% of its enlisted men had been deployed abroad. The Marines conducted proportionally more amphibious assaults than the Army; these landings were often followed by some of the most brutal combat experienced by U.S. forces. The outbreak of World War II set in motion a massive expansion of the United States Marine Corps, leading to a 24-fold increase in size by August 1945. This book is the first of several volumes to examine the Corps's meteoric wartime expansion and the evolution of its units. It covers the immediate pre-war period, the rush to deploy defense forces in the war's early months, and the Marines' first combat operations on Guadalcanal, New Georgia, and Bougainville. It focuses on the 1st, 2d, and 3d Marine Divisions (MarDivs) and the provisional 1st, 2d, and 3d Marine Brigades (MarBdes).

The ferocity of the Pacific war almost defied the available military technology. In this environment the evolving use of tanks by the US Marine Corps played a significant role; at the end of the Battle of Okinawa, Major General Lemuel Shepherd wrote in his report that 'if any one supporting arm can be singled out as having contributed more than any others during the progress of the campaign, the tank would certainly be selected.' This book traces the history of the US Marine Corps tank crewman, including the significant changes in doctrine, equipment, and organization that the war brought, and his experience fighting in the Pacific theater.
